Hey y’all,

My first three cooks on my new 700 went perfectly, I didn’t have any temperature issues at all. But today I’m having problems. The grill is getting way hotter than the set temp sometimes by 70 degrees.
I’ve changed the feed rate from factory 6.50% to 3.50% and it’s still getting and staying hotter than the set temp.
The grill is in the shade and it’s not hotter than it was for my first three cooks. What could be happening?

Check to make sure the thermocouple isnt blocked by foil or filthy. That's the rod on the left inside the grill. It could be sending a false signal the the electronics. If not that you could have a bad board. Call rectec and tell them whats going on. If its the board they'll ship you out a new one at no cost.
 
If you clean the probe, do so carefully. It could be build-up on the probe. Do you use a smoke tube? ??

Things change, weather, sun exposure, pellets quality even if they are the same brand, how the grill is being used, last cook and I can't explain it. I set my Bull to 3.0 before I even did the initial burn in last July and its been pretty much rock solid on the lower temperatures except when opening the lid for more than a couple of minutes or so, It will drop then over shoot for a while then calm back down in 15 to 20 minutes when this happens. If I know I'm going to have the lid open to move things around, add more food or to just poke at the cook for a longer time I try to remember to turn the controllers temperature down to LO, do what I need to do and reset the temperature to the original or new temp settings I'm looking for.
